New list up - big thanks to Onyx. Relevant proposed BL changes added (helltalons, oblit costs, Warlord, vindicators, terminators cost) Basilisk+Predators added to upgrades Grand battery point reduced Defiler, Vindicator formations points reduced Siegehammer - rhinos removed, dreadclaws added as upgrade Dreads - dreadclaws added as upgrade Latest list - http://onyxworkshop.files.wordpress.com ... s-v1-0.pdf (September 8th2012) I've been working on this for a while. It combines elements of several other IW lists into a attacking siege list IRON WARRIORS Strategy 4 Initiative 1 (navy+spacecraft 2+) CORE Iron Warriors Company 300pts 1 IW character upgrade 6 Chaos Marines and 2 Havocs Upgrades: Daemon Prince, Chaos Dreadnoughts, Chaos Siege Dreadnoughts, Obliterators, Chaos Land Raiders, Chaos Vindicators, Chaos Rhinos, Warsmith, Cult Marines, Havocs, IW Assault Marines Defiler Assault Pack 275pts 4 Defilers Upgrades: Defilers, Chaos Dreadnoughts, Chaos Siege Dreadnoughts, Chaos Vindicators Grand Battery 9 Chaos Basilisks 700pts Upgrades: Emplacements Armoured Assault Company 300pts 6 Chaos Vindicators Upgrades: Chaos Vindicators, Defilers SIEGE SUPPORT 0-2 per CORE Super Heavy Company 1-3 Chaos Stormswords or Decimators 225pts per tank Upgrades: Chaos Vindicators, Chaos Basilisks, Defilers Battery 3 Chaos Basilisks 300pts Upgrades: Emplacements Armoured Company Four to Eight Chaos Predators and/or Chaos Land Raiders 50 per Predator, 75 per Land Raider in any combination Upgrades: Chaos Vindicators, Chaos Basilisks, Defilers Daemonic Artillery 3 Daemonic Artillery units 350pts Upgrades: Emplacements SIEGE ASSAULT 0-1 per Core Raptors 175pts One IW Lord Character and four Raptors Upgrades Raptors Dreadnoughts Siegehammer Company 275pts 1 IW Lord Character upgrade, 6 IW Assault Marines and 3 Rhinos Chosen Four Chaos Marine Chosen Units 125pts Upgrades: Dreadclaws, Chaos Rhinos, Chaos Dreadnoughts Terminators One IW Lord Character and four IW terminators 275pts Upgrades: Chaos Dreadnought, Defilers, Chaos Land Raiders, Obliterators, Daemon Prince, Warlord, IW Terminators DARK MECHANICUS Siegelord 800 Ravager 650 Ordinatus Chaotica - Horus Pattern 600 NAVY Hellblades Helltalons Harbinger Spacecraft UPGRADES Rhinos 10pts each Obliterators 85pts each Chaos Dreadnought 50pts each Siege Dreadnought 75pts each Chaos Land Raider 0-4 at 75pts each Defilers 0-3 at 75pts each Dreadclaws 5pts per unit in the formation Havocs 4 Havocs for 150pts 0-1 Daemon Prince Replaces the character in a formation for 50pts Chaos Vindicators 50pts each Emplacements 3 gun emplacements for 50pts, you cannot take more emplacements than vehicles in the formation IW Assault Marines 4 Assault Marines for 150pts Raptors Up to 4 for 35pts each ORDINATUS CHAOTICA - HORUS PATTERN War Engine 10cm 5+ 6+ 4+ 2xHeavy Bolter 30cm AP5+ 2xLascannon 45cm AT4+ Sonic Disruptor 100cm 10BP, Ignore Cover, Disrupt Critical Hit: The Ordinatus’s plasma reactor explodes in a roiling blast of energy, the war engine is destroyed and all units within 15cm suffer a hit on a 4+ Damage Capacity 4, 4 Void Shields, Reinforced Armour. SIEGELORD War Engine 15cm 4+ 2+ 3+ 2x Siege Launcher 60cm BP3 Powerclaw (base) Assault Weapon Extra Attacks (+3) Titan killer (D3) OR Ironfist Assault pod - Transport (10) Terminators and Dreadnoughts take 2 spaces Gatling Blaster 60cm 4xAP4+/AT4+ Tail (base) Extra Attack (+1) Damage Capacity 8, 6 Void Shields, Crit Notes: Fearless, Reinforced Armour, Walker, Thick Rear Armour DAEMONIC ARTILLERY AV 15cm 4+ 4+ 6+ Daemonic Barrage 45cm 1BP Ignore Cover Notes: Fearless, Invulnerable Save IW LORD Character - - - - Daemon Weapon (base) Assault Weapon, Macro Weapon, Extra Attack (+1) Servo Arms (base) Assault Weapon, Extra Attacks (+2) Notes: IW Lords can be one of two types : Warsmith or Lord. All are characters and have the Leader and Invulnerable Save abilities. Lords have the Commander ability, Warsmiths have the Supreme Commander ability. Both types may choose either the Daemon Weapon or Servo Arms. CHAOS SIEGE DREADNOUGHT AV 15cm 3+ 4+ 4+ Siege Hammer (base) assault weapon MW Extra Attack (+1) Siege Drill (base) assault weapon Extra Attack (+1) Notes: Reinforced Armour IRON WARRIOR ASSAULT MARINES Infantry 15cm 4+ 3+ 4+ Bolters (15cm) small arms Hand Weapons (base) assault weapons IRON WARRIOR TERMINATORS Infantry 15cm 4+ 3+ 3+ Combi-bolters (15cm) Small arms Power Weapons (base) Assault weapons Macro Weapon, Extra Attacks (+1) Reaper Autocannon 30cm AP4+/AT6+ Heavy Flamer 15cm AP4+ Ignore Cover and (15cm) Small Arms Ignore Cover Notes: Reinforced Armour, Thick Rear Armour, Teleport. Heavy Flamer confers the Ignore Cover ability on the units FF attack CHAOS STORMSWORD War Engine 15cm 4+ 6+ 4+ Siege Cannon 45cm 3BP Disrupt, Ignore Cover, Fixed Forward Arc Heavy Bolter 30cm AP5+ 2xTwin Heavy Bolter 30cm AP4+ 2xTwin Heavy Flamer 15cm AP4+ Ignore Cover Notes: DC3, Crit |

Author: | Steve54 [ Sun Jun 05, 2011 7:17 am ] |
Post subject: | Re: Iron Warriors 0.2 |
Thanks for the upbeat response+feedback Terminators - I agree they might need a points increase in time Ordinatus - the HH book (Fallen Angels?) is the inspiration for it. I'll dig the book out today and check the weapon as its some time since I wrote that out. Daemonic artillery - would they be better with indirect or is there enough indirect already? Wahounds - I left them out to try and avoid the ubiquitous fast WEs that most lists end up using if they are available to them. Also there is no reference to them in Storm oF Iron where a large titan contingent is used. Furthermore the idea of the list is that it is for storming a fortress and I thought warhounds wouldn't really fit that. Emplacements - Indeed a note that their formation must be deployed in them would be a good idea |
